Selecting Between JD and LLB Degrees
When commencing on a legal profession, students often find themselves at a crucial juncture: picking between a Juris Doctor (JD) and a Bachelor of Laws (LLB). Though both degrees equip students for legal practice, there are distinct differences in their structure, content, and ultimate goals. The JD, primarily offered in the United States, focuses on applied legal abilities, while the LLB, more prevalent in common law systems, provides a broader framework in legal theory.
- Moreover, the JD typically concludes with experiential learning opportunities, allowing students to use their knowledge in real-world settings.
- On the other hand, the LLB often focuses on legal inquiry and conceptual .
Finally, the best choice between a JD and an LLB depends on an individual's objectives for their legal career.
